Where does “vyplavat” come from?

vyplavat (Czech) comes from Czech plavat, from Old Czech plavati, from Proto-Slavic plavati, from Proto-Slavic plàviti, from Proto-Slavic -vati.

vyplavat (Czech): to swim out, to surface, to rise to the surface

Definitions

  1. to swim out, to surface, to rise to the surface
